Comprehensive Translation Tool for Mac Users

Saladict Translator is a versatile document management application designed for Mac users, offering a range of features that simplify the translation process. With capabilities such as text selection translation, screenshot translation, and input translation, users can quickly obtain translations with minimal effort. The program supports advanced AI translation technologies, making it a reliable choice for accurate results. Moreover, it integrates various dictionaries to enhance understanding and learning of words.

In addition to its translation features, Saladict Translator includes an OCR function that allows users to recognize text from screenshots, even offline. The application also supports multi-translation, enabling users to compare results from multiple platforms simultaneously. With a vocabulary book, translation history, and plugin options for additional functionality, Saladict Translator is a powerful tool that enhances productivity and efficiency for both work and study.
